Best Sights and Neighborhoods to Visit in Natick, MA

Natick, Massachusetts, is a town of approximately 37,000 residents in Middlesex County — one of the most culturally ambitious and most geographically rewarding MetroWest communities in Greater Boston, a place whose combination of a beloved independent arts venue in a converted firehouse, a sweeping Mass Audubon wildlife sanctuary in the heart of town, a walkable downtown center with some of the best independent restaurants in the region, and the South Natick village’s stunning falls along the Charles River give it a depth and distinctiveness that consistently surprise visitors expecting only another suburban stop along the Massachusetts Turnpike. Incorporated in 1651, Natick is one of the oldest towns in Massachusetts and carries the distinction of having been the site of one of the most significant “Praying Indian” communities in colonial New England — a town established by missionary John Eliot as a place for Christianized Wampanoag and other Native Americans to live, whose legacy is preserved through the town’s historical society and museum. South Natick Falls at Mill Lane in South Natick village is Natick’s most strikingly beautiful and most photographically beloved natural landmark — accessible 24 hours with an absolutely stunning little waterfall and paved pathway along the Charles River, several benches to sit and rest, accessible pathway, frogs, ducks, geese, and other wildlife regularly present, and the Natick History Museum and Bacon Free Library sitting on the same adorable street making it one of the most picturesque civic corners in all of MetroWest — described as one of the favorite places in all of New England for sitting, picnicking, and getting grounded and centered, as a must-see where prom pictures and senior pictures come out amazing, and as a beautiful place where a small waterfall and waterside benches make it perfect for a lunch stop. Natick’s outdoor landscape is shaped by the Charles River to the south and a remarkable collection of conservation properties that make this town one of the most trail-rich communities in MetroWest — from Mass Audubon’s sprawling Broadmoor Wildlife Sanctuary to the town forests threading through the residential neighborhoods. Mass Audubon’s Broadmoor Wildlife Sanctuary at 280 Eliot Street is Natick’s most ecologically magnificent and most strikingly varied outdoor destination — open Tuesday through Sunday from 9 AM with easy scenic trails through forests, meadows, and boardwalks over wetlands, turtles, ducks, birds, and abundant wildlife throughout, boardwalk views described as a must-see, a visitor center with an energetic staff member described as really full of energy, and free admission for Natick and Sherborn residents — described as a hidden gem perfect for a relaxing walk, birdwatching, and spotting wildlife without going far, as an extremely beautiful place full of great spots for walks and photography and a perfect place to see wildlife that is a gem in the area and a must visit, and as a beautiful wildlife reservation where the boardwalk is amazing and there are more trails to keep exploring on every visit. Cochituate State Park at 43 Commonwealth Road is Natick’s most expansively family-complete and most actively recreational state park — open from 8 AM with kayaking, rowing, and paddleboarding on Lake Cochituate, picnic areas with tables near the water, open fields perfect for soccer, and a beach where swimming is possible when algae conditions permit — described as a nice place to take a walk, have a picnic, or go boating with kids, as a wonderful place for families to BBQ and relax with lots of fields for soccer, and as a beautiful park great for dogs and picnics with paddleboarding always fun even when swimming is off.
